Mohini Dang vs State Of U.P .

Supreme Court10 May 2018Mohan M. Shantanagoudar · Kurian Joseph

Ratio decidendi

The rule this decision rests on

Where a party has been allotted land by a development authority at a specified rate and area but seeks an alternative plot of larger size, the fair and equitable resolution is that the party shall pay the present market rate only for the land in excess of the originally allotted area, while all other charges shall be calculated at the present market rate applied to the entire new plot, with credit given for any amounts previously paid or offered by the authority.

J U D G M E N T

KURIAN, J.

Leave granted.

2. The appellant was allotted Plot No.54, Ambedkar

Road by the Ghaziabad Development Authority as per

offer letter dated 14.10.1986. The price of land at

that time was Rs.2,000/- per sq. mtr. The area of

the plot was 175 sq. mtr. Though there is a

chequered history as to what happened after 1986, in

the nature of the order we propose to pass, it is not

necessary to go into the same in detail. However, it

is to be noted that on 24.09.2013, the Authority had

made an attempt to return the money with interest.

But it is seen from the subsequent correspondence

that the appellant has not actually received the

money.

3. Be that as it may, when the matter was being

Signature Not Verified heard by this Court, it was enquired as to whether Digitally signed by NARENDRA PRASAD Date: 2018.05.14 17:50:15 IST Reason: any vacant plot of size of 175 sq. mtr. or larger

size is available. On instruction, it was reported

1 that two plots have been spared from the auction and

the appellant is free to choose one plot. We find

that the appellant has exercised his option for Plot

No.AC-15, Ambedkar Road with an area of 207.11 sq.

mtr. The present rate is Rs.61,500/- per sq. mtr.

Since the appellant had already been allotted plot of

175 sq. mtr. in 1986 and for which he had paid an

amount of Rs.3,19,375/-, we are of the view that it

is only just, fair, equitable and complete justice

between the parties that as far as the actual land

value is concerned, the appellant is required to pay

the present rate only for the land in excess of 175

sq. mtr. As far as other charges are concerned, the

same will be calculated at the present market rate of

the entire plot i.e. treating the land value as

Rs.1,27,37,265/-. The amount offered to the

appellant in 2013 will be duly adjusted.

4. The appellant is directed to furnish the original

documents to the Authority. The Authority is

directed to furnish a fresh calculation to the

appellant within a period of one month from today, in

the light of our order and the appellant shall remit

the amount, in terms of the communication by the

Authority within two months thereafter.

5. The impugned judgment will stand modified to the

above extent and the appeal is, accordingly, allowed

as above.

2

6. Pending applications, if any, stand disposed of.

7. There shall be no orders as to costs.
